Plain English Meaning
A tablet or similar device that holds all the maps, charts, manuals, and reference material a pilot used to carry as paper.
Full Definition
An electronic flight bag (EFB) is a portable electronic device used by pilots to display information traditionally carried in paper form, including charts, approach plates, checklists, aircraft manuals, weather data, and performance calculations. EFBs range from commercial tablets running aviation apps to certified installed units, and may be authorized for various functions depending on aircraft, operator, and regulatory approval.
